What is a characteristic of a varifocal lens?

Explanation:
A varifocal lens is designed with the capability to change its focal length, allowing the user to zoom in or out as needed. This characteristic enables the lens to be adjusted for different perspectives and object distances, which can be done either manually or through motorized controls. This flexibility is fundamental to varifocal lenses, differentiating them from fixed lenses that only provide a single set focal length. The ability to adjust the focus enhances versatility in various applications, whether in surveillance, photography, or any scenario where adapting to changing conditions is necessary. This feature elevates the lens's usability, making it suitable for environments where the subject matter may be at varying distances.
